The Brindle load balancer marks a node unhealthy after three consecutive failed probes to the readiness endpoint. Before escalating, confirm whether the failure is node-local (one instance flapping) or fleet-wide (probe config or dependency outage). Node-local: drain the instance and file a ticket. Fleet-wide: this is a severity-two incident; page the on-call immediately and note probe timestamps in the incident channel. If the on-call does not acknowledge within fifteen minutes, escalate directly by writing to the platform leads.

escalation mailbox, bafog-fafog: ulador@paliqlabs.internal

## Sensor drift: what to do at 3am

If the GrowLoop controller starts reporting humidity swings that don't match the backup probes in the Fernwick greenhouse, it's almost always sensor drift, not an actual climate event. Don't panic and don't touch the vents manually. First, restart the calibration daemon and give it ten minutes to re-baseline. If readings still disagree by more than 5%, flip the controller into safe mode. The safe-mode thresholds it will use are these.

config for yahap-bajof:
[istix]
host = istix.qorvelsys.internal
user = istix_svc
database = istix_prod

Welcome to on-call for Hexwire. The event schema registry is the thing that pages most. Rules: never delete a schema version, never approve a breaking change without a migration note, and reject any PR that skips compatibility checks. Registry restarts are safe; compactions are not — escalate those to the Bramleigh platform team. Validation steps and the rollback procedure are on the internal page.

wiki page, fahaf-yagag: https://confluence.qorvellabs.internal/pages/display/pages/display

Ticket: config drift in Mailwright digest scheduler (prod vs. declared state). The nightly digest for the Oakhollow tenant fired twice on consecutive days. Audit shows a hand-edit on prod host two weeks ago changed the batching window and cron expression, diverging from what's in the repo. Proposed fix: revert the host to declared values and enable drift alerts on this service. Reviewer, please confirm the reverted values match intent before I apply. The canonical configuration we are restoring is as follows.

deployment values, yadug-bawif:
[framir]
team = pelox
access_code = ac_a38ab2
owner = tamion.julael
host = framir.tolvaqlabs.test
port = 11211
peer = tammir.zemvargrid.local
salt = 2215ef03
pin = 1541